Ken Robinson, TEDTalks

This lecture deals with children, schools and creativity.

Ken Robinson makes the case that today’s schools are educating children out of their creativity at a time when they need it more than ever — and that it is crucial to help them engage their innate talents.

Besides, Sir Ken Robinson has an impressive sense of humour that makes his lecture really fascinating.
